Technical Specifications

ParameterValue
Axes5‑axis (XYZ + A + C)
Spindle Speed5 000 – 30 000 rpm
Tool Capacity30 tools (automatic changer)
Positional Accuracy±0.001 mm (linear), ±0.005° (rotary)
Repeatability±0.0005 mm
Max Workpiece Size500 mm × 500 mm × 300 mm
Surface Roughness (Ra)≤0.4 µm (standard), ≤0.2 µm (high‑finish)
Material CompatibilityAluminum, Titanium, PEEK, LSR, Medical‑grade polymers
Cycle Time ReductionUp to 40 % vs. 3‑axis
